首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何处理typescript中的数字输入?

在TypeScript中处理数字输入可以通过以下几个步骤:

  1. 接收输入:可以使用HTML中的input元素或JavaScript中的prompt函数等方式获取用户输入的数字。
  2. 类型检查:TypeScript是静态类型语言,可以使用类型注解或类型推断来确保输入是数字类型。例如,可以使用number类型注解来声明变量或函数参数的类型为数字。
  3. 输入验证:对于用户输入的数字,可以进行验证以确保其符合特定的要求。例如,可以检查输入是否为空、是否为有效的数字、是否在指定的范围内等。
  4. 转换和处理:根据具体需求,可以将输入的数字进行转换或处理。例如,可以将字符串类型的输入转换为数字类型,进行数值计算、比较、格式化等操作。

以下是一个示例代码,演示了如何处理typescript中的数字输入:

代码语言:txt
复制
// 接收输入
const input: string = prompt("请输入一个数字");
const numberInput: number = parseFloat(input);

// 类型检查
if (isNaN(numberInput)) {
  console.log("输入不是有效的数字");
} else {
  // 输入验证
  if (numberInput < 0 || numberInput > 100) {
    console.log("输入的数字超出范围");
  } else {
    // 转换和处理
    const squaredNumber: number = numberInput ** 2;
    console.log(`输入的数字的平方为:${squaredNumber}`);
  }
}

在腾讯云的产品中,可以使用云函数SCF(Serverless Cloud Function)来处理数字输入。SCF是一种无服务器计算服务,可以根据实际需求动态分配计算资源,支持多种编程语言,包括JavaScript/TypeScript。您可以使用SCF来编写处理数字输入的函数,并通过API网关等方式接收用户输入。

腾讯云云函数SCF产品介绍链接:https://cloud.tencent.com/product/scf

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券